What is Semaglutide?
Semaglutide Pill (Https://Rentry.Co) is a gl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) receptor agonist, a class of drugs created to simulate the action of the incretin hormonal agents that the body releases in action to food consumption. By enhancing insulin secretion, decreasing glucagon secretion, and slowing stomach emptying, Semaglutide plays a crucial role in controling blood sugar level levels. Initially authorized by the FDA for the treatment of type 2 diabetes under the brand name Ozempic, Semaglutide was later presented in a greater dose for weight management as Wegovy.

Semaglutide has been shown to provide various benefits, especially for individuals battling with obesity and type 2 diabetes. Below is a list of essential advantages:
Effective Weight Loss: Clinical trials have actually demonstrated that individuals taking Semaglutide lost significantly more weight compared to those on placebo.Enhanced Glycemic Control: It helps in much better glycemic control, leading to lower HbA1c levels.Cardiovascular Benefits: Some studies recommend that Semaglutide might help in reducing the threat of major cardiovascular occasions in individuals with type 2 diabetes.Convenience: Available in both injection kind and oral tablets, Semaglutide Prescription offers versatility for clients.Long-lasting Effects: The medication may offer continual weight-loss and glycemic control when used regularly.Efficacy in Clinical Trials

While Semaglutide offers various benefits, possible negative effects exist. It's vital for individuals considering this medication to speak with health care specialists to determine if it's appropriate for them. Common adverse effects include:
Gastrointestinal Issues: Nausea, throwing up, diarrhea, and constipation are among the most noted adverse effects.Hypoglycemia: There is a danger of low blood sugar, particularly when utilized with other diabetes medications.Increased Heart Rate: Some patients may experience a boost in heart rate.Injection Site Reactions: For injectable kinds, users may come across inflammation at the injection website.Rarer however Serious Risks
Although uncommon, some severe adverse effects can take place:
Pancreatitis: Inflammation of the pancreas has been reported.Kidney Problems: There have been cases of acute kidney injury.Thyroid Tumors: In animal studies, Semaglutide has been connected to thyroid growths, consisting of medullary thyroid carcinoma.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Who should think about Semaglutide pills?
Semaglutide is mainly targeted at adults with obesity (BMI of 30 or greater) or those with overweight (BMI of 27 or greater) who also have at least one weight-related medical condition. It can likewise be helpful for those with type 2 diabetes struggling to achieve glycemic control.
2. How is Semaglutide taken?
Semaglutide can be administered through injection or orally. Initially, clients are recommended to start on a low dosage, gradually increasing to the target dose over a specific period, generally 4 weeks.
3. For how long does it take to see results?
Clients may begin to discover weight loss within the very first couple of weeks of treatment, with more substantial results usually visible after 12-16 weeks.
4. Is Semaglutide suitable for everyone?
No, Semaglutide may not appropriate for people with a history of certain medical conditions, consisting of person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or multiple endocrine neoplasia syndrome type 2 (MEN 2). Constantly consult a doctor.
5. Can Semaglutide be utilized long-term?
Yes, research studies recommend that Semaglutide can be utilized long-lasting for weight management and diabetes control. However, specific treatment plans should be frequently examined by health care professionals.
